Are the Museums and Historical Sights Better in Riga or Wernigerode?

Riga
Wernigerode

Plenty of people visit the great sights and museums in both Riga and Wernigerode.

Riga offers many unique museums, sights, and landmarks that will make for a memorable trip. As a capital city with a diverse history, you'll find a number of museums and landmarks in the area. Visitors frequently visit The Freedom Monument, St. Peters Church, the Riga Cathedral, The House of the Black Heads, and any of the many museums around town.

Many visitors head to Wernigerode specifically to visit some of its top-rated museums and other sights. In addition to its beautiful old town, the highlight of a visit to this town is exploring the Wernigerode Castle. Other attractions include the Museum für Luftfahrt und Technik and the Miniaturenpark.


Is the Food Better in Riga or Wernigerode? Which Destination has the Best Restaurants?

Riga
Wernigerode

Riga is a well-known place for its local cuisine and restaurants. Also, Wernigerode is not as famous, but is still a good town to visit for its restaurants.

With its innovative style combined with traditional elements, Riga makes for a great culinary experience. The city offers a great opportunity to try many Latvian specialties including rasol (a potato salad), pelmeni (a Latvian dumpling), and karbonade (kind of like schnitzel). The cuisine is hearty and filling with lots of bread, dumpling, and meats. Riga is also where you'll find the largest food market in Europe, which is the perfect place to wander and pick up some local items.

Wernigerode has a delicious restaurant scene that relies on local flavors. As a touristy town, you'll find a number of restaurants that serve traditional food. There are also sausage stands and plenty of ice cream shops.

Is Riga or Wernigerode Better for Nightlife?

Riga
Wernigerode

Riga is very popular for nightlife. However, Wernigerode is not a good town for nightlife and partying.

Riga is a party destination, and you'll find plenty of activity all night long. Despite being a small city, this capital has gained a reputation for its party atmosphere. The historic center comes to life in the evenings, particularly between Wednesdays and Saturdays. The area is compact enough that you can walk from club to club and prices are reasonable.

Those looking for nightlife will find a few places to hang out in Wernigerode. The small town isn't known for its nightlife scene but there are plenty of places where you can grab a beer and have a relaxing night.

Which place is cheaper, Wernigerode or Riga?

These are the overall average travel costs for the two destinations.

The average daily cost (per person) in Riga is €104, while the average daily cost in Wernigerode is €136. These costs include accommodation (assuming double occupancy, so the traveler is sharing the room), food, transportation, and entertainment. While every person is different, these costs are an average of past travelers in each destination. What follows is a categorical breakdown of travel costs for Riga and Wernigerode in more detail.

When is the best time to visit Riga or Wernigerode?

Both destinations experience a temperate climate with four distinct seasons. And since both cities are in the northern hemisphere, summer is in July and winter is in January.

Should I visit Riga or Wernigerode in the Summer?

Both Wernigerode and Riga are popular destinations to visit in the summer with plenty of activities. The city activities and the family-friendly experiences are the main draw to Riga this time of year. Also, many travelers come to Wernigerode for the small town charm and the family-friendly experiences.

In July, Riga is generally around the same temperature as Wernigerode. Daily temperatures in Riga average around 17°C (63°F), and Wernigerode fluctuates around 19°C (65°F).

In July, Riga usually receives more rain than Wernigerode. Riga gets 79 mm (3.1 in) of rain, while Wernigerode receives 50 mm (2 in) of rain each month for the summer.

Should I visit Riga or Wernigerode in the Autumn?

Both Wernigerode and Riga during the autumn are popular places to visit. Many travelers come to Riga for the city's sights and attractions, the shopping scene, and the natural beauty of the area. Furthermore, many visitors come to Wernigerode in the autumn for the small town atmosphere.

Riga is much colder than Wernigerode in the autumn. The daily temperature in Riga averages around 7°C (45°F) in October, and Wernigerode fluctuates around 11°C (52°F).

Riga usually gets more rain in October than Wernigerode. Riga gets 60 mm (2.4 in) of rain, while Wernigerode receives 35 mm (1.4 in) of rain this time of the year.

Should I visit Riga or Wernigerode in the Winter?

The winter attracts plenty of travelers to both Riga and Wernigerode. Many visitors come to Riga in the winter for the museums, the shopping scene, and the cuisine. Furthermore, most visitors come to Wernigerode for the museums and the cuisine during these months.

Wernigerode can be very cold during winter. Riga can get quite cold in the winter. In the winter, Riga is much colder than Wernigerode. Typically, the winter temperatures in Riga in January average around -5°C (23°F), and Wernigerode averages at about 2°C (35°F).

In January, Riga usually receives less rain than Wernigerode. Riga gets 33 mm (1.3 in) of rain, while Wernigerode receives 40 mm (1.6 in) of rain each month for the winter.

Should I visit Riga or Wernigerode in the Spring?

The spring brings many poeple to Riga as well as Wernigerode. Most visitors come to Riga for the activities around the city and the natural beauty during these months. Additionally, the spring months attract visitors to Wernigerode because of the small town charm.

In April, Riga is generally much colder than Wernigerode. Daily temperatures in Riga average around 5°C (42°F), and Wernigerode fluctuates around 9°C (48°F).

Riga usually gets less rain in April than Wernigerode. Riga gets 39 mm (1.5 in) of rain, while Wernigerode receives 51 mm (2 in) of rain this time of the year.
